Cut through a variety of surfaces with the Bobcat® wheel saw attachment. Powered by a high-flow Bobcat® loader, wheel saw models WS18 and WS24 cut through asphalt, concrete, frozen ground and wire mesh. With trenching depths of 6 to 24 inches, depending on the model, these rugged attachments are used for road repair and for laying water, gas, electric and fiber-optic cables. The trench cleaner, which is raised and lowered hydraulically, assures a clean trench. Bobcat® wheel saws provide a more precise cut than air or hydraulic hammers and are easier to transport than dedicated machines.
